New
Medication Restrictions in Medicaid Concern Advocates
for the Mentally Ill
The National Alliance for the Mentally Ill (NAMI)
Maine is very
concerned about new restrictions on psychiatric medications
in the
Medicaid program. They are asking people who have
any trouble at all in receiving their prescription
to call NAMI at 1-800-464-5767.
If you, or someone you know, is turned away at the
pharmacy because there is no prior authorization for
the medication or can't continue taking the medication
that is working because of the new step therapy rules,
NAMI Maine wants to know. NAMI is trying to understand
the impact of the new Medicaid rules. You can also
email Carol Carothers at clcarothers@gwi.net
instead of calling.
